| 0:24.9 | One of the most persistent human struggles that we all encounter is the problem of worry. |
| 0:30.4 | Everyone knows what it is to confront this problem. |
| 0:33.4 | Some struggle with the sort of low-grade fever of worry over whether they'll have enough money to pay their bills at the end of the month. |
| 0:39.9 | Others face the more extreme kind of anxiety that leads to the labored breathing and chest pains of a panic attack. |
| 0:46.7 | Whether the problem is on the mild or the extreme end of things, we all face it, and that means we must have a biblical response for it. |
